Store uploaded files to your Medusa backend locally.
Not suited for production environments
Plugin Documentation | Medusa Website | Medusa Repository
- Store product images locally
1. Run the following command in the directory of the Medusa backend:
npm install @tlukastee/file-local
2 . In medusa-config.js
add the following at the end of the plugins
array:
const plugins = [
// ...
{
resolve: `@tlukastee/file-local`,
options: {
upload_dir: 'uploads/images', // optional
backend_url: 'http://localhost:9000' // optional
}
},
]
1. Run the following command in the directory of the Medusa backend to run the backend:
npm run start
2. Upload an image for a product using the admin dashboard or using the Admin APIs.